I didn't want to hijack Denny's thread so I'll start a new one.
I was riding yesterday and the Wolf shuts off. Unlike Denny's problem I'm getting power to the EHC. Battery is less than 2 weeks old. All connectors are tight that are accessible. When I turn the key on the speedo and turn signals flicker then nothing. The battery will checkout at 12.98v but when you turn the key on it will continue to drop voltage to around 4v. Turn the key off and the battery will rebound to 12.98v. Something is putting a significant load on the battery. If the battery was bad (new Interstate) it wouldn't rebound. I'll pull it and check it out for sure but I'm almost positive i'm not going to be that lucky. I pulled the shroud around the EHC to get to the fuses and nothing appears to be wrong. I did find one wire that had chaffed thru the outer jacket but it didn't get into the inner wires (just a matter of time though). Does this problem sound familiar to anybody? If this turns out to be an EHC problem will a Wire Plus kit work with an EFI motor? Are they available for 09 Models? Thanks in advance

Maybe your starter solenoid is stuck in the energized position? Or a possible wire that's ground out on the frame somewhere. That's the only thing I can think of that will pull such a draw... Did you check all your connections for tightness?
